Responsibilities

  • Maintains ownership of and manages contract process to ensure timely delivery and execution consistent with standard cycle times, including but not limited to, the coordination and finalization of the contractual instrument to align with defined scope of work.
  • Leads the negotiation and preparation of both financial and contractual terms within complex customer agreements, identifying financial risks, assessing budget impacts, and validating all contract changes to ensure alignment with internal standards.
  • Drives quarterly contracting targets through active workload management and prioritization and setting of plans for delivery and execution.
  • Develops internal stakeholder relationships and works independently with Project Leads, Business Development, and Customer on assigned projects.
  • Updates and maintains timely records in Customer Relationship Management (CRM) system and Contract Management System based on Customer Contract Management (CCM) processes throughout the day on a daily basis.
  • Works consistently within the department's metrics/timelines for completion of documents and related tasks.
  • Evaluates contracts for completeness and accuracy by comparing to department guidelines to determine adherence and ensures that corrections are appropriately made and documented to ensure the highest quality document is always delivered.
  • Maintains a high level of flexibility. Proactively creates and resets priorities as the need arises to adhere to standard turnaround times. Identifies and raises issues before they become critical and adjusts quickly to the changes of a dynamic organization.
